Helpful For

Assessing the reason for irregular serum magnesium concentrations
utilizing a 24-hour urine assortment

 

Figuring out whether or not dietary magnesium masses are ample

 

Calculating urinary calcium oxalate and calcium phosphate
supersaturation and assessing kidney stone threat

 

Scientific Data – “magnesium 24”

Magnesium, together with potassium, is a serious intracellular
cation. Magnesium is a cofactor of many enzyme techniques. All
adenosine triphosphate-dependent enzymatic reactions require
magnesium as a cofactor. Roughly 70% of magnesium ions are
saved in bone. The rest are concerned in middleman
metabolic processes; about 70% are current in free type, whereas the
different 30% are sure to proteins (particularly albumin), citrates,
phosphate, and different complicated formers. The serum magnesium stage is
stored fixed inside very slender limits

Renal dealing with of magnesium is set by the mixture of
filtration and reabsorption. Roughly 70% of the magnesium in plasma
is filtered by the glomeruli; 20% to 30% of the filtered magnesium
is reabsorbed within the proximal tubule, whereas lower than 5% is
reabsorbed within the distal tubule and gathering duct.(1)

 

Quite a few causes of renal magnesium losing have been recognized
together with (however not restricted to) congenital defects (together with Barter
and Gitelman syndrome), numerous endocrine problems (together with
hyperaldosteronism and hyperparathyroidism), publicity to sure
medicine (ie, diuretics, cis-platinum, aminoglycoside antibiotics,
calcineurin inhibitors), and different miscellaneous causes (together with
persistent alcohol abuse). Gastrointestinal situations related to
fats malabsorption and persistent diarrhea may cause fecal magnesium
loss and hypomagnesemia. Excessive ranges of plasma magnesium are
sometimes solely seen in sufferers with decreased renal perform,
after administration of a magnesium load massive sufficient to exceed the
kidneys’ skill to excrete it, or a mix of the two.(2)

Magnesium is an inhibitor of calcium crystal progress and
contributes to urinary calcium oxalate and calcium phosphate
supersaturation. Nevertheless, low urinary magnesium in isolation has
not been recognized as a standard reason for kidney stones, nor has
magnesium supplementation been confirmed as an efficient remedy for
stone prevention.

 

Interpretation

Urinary magnesium excretion ought to be interpreted in live performance
with serum concentrations.

 

Within the presence of hypomagnesemia, a 24-hour urine magnesium
better than 24 mg/day or fractional excretion better than 0.5%
suggests renal magnesium losing. Decrease values recommend insufficient
magnesium consumption and/or gastrointestinal losses.

 

Within the presence of hypermagnesemia, urinary magnesium ranges
present a sign of present magnesium consumption.

 

Decrease urinary magnesium excretion will increase urinary calcium
oxalate and calcium phosphate supersaturation and will contribute
to kidney stone threat.
